Why Veterans Face Unique Foot Challenges Military service creates specific foot care needs: Stress Fractures : High impact training and long marches put significant stress on foot and ankle bones Chronic Ankle Instability : Service related injuries can lead to recurring ankle problems Plantar Fasciitis : Extended periods in heavy boots contribute to heel and arch pain Diabetic Foot Complications : If you're managing service connected diabetes, foot care is critical Heel Pain : Repetitive impact from military activities often results in persistent heel issues VA Benefits and Your Podiatry Care Dr. Robert Hoover has extensive experience working with veterans and understands the VA benefits process.
